    Ocean West reacted to SeNioR- in constants.php   
    This was added in IPS 4.4 or 4.5.
    Adding backslash means "load from the root namespace for performance reasons".
    Using the root namespace allows PHP to use Opcode to run the function which can be much quicker.

    Ocean West reacted to Jordan Miller in Please restore the choice of reactions here at IPS!   
    Appreciate you taking the time to write this @The Old Man!
    My logic for removing the "sad" and "confused" reactions was two-fold. For one, they were extremely underutilized according to the reports. More importantly (imo), if someone feels confused or sad, we want to encourage you guys to write out a response. Those are more fragile emotions, so I felt, and still feel, that if someone is sad or confused about something, that it's important they take the time to respond why they feel that way. If they're confused, it gives them an opportunity to seek clarification from someone in a reply. And if they are sad, it allows them the freedom to explain why. 
    Most platforms stopped offering a "dislike" option because it causes unnecessary conflict. I can attest to this personally on my own community. A few members were using it non-stop to essentially start fights - especially if their posting was restricted (they can still use reactions as a form of communication). We removed the option to "dislike" replies and it created a friendlier environment. 
    YouTube is one of the only places left where you can dislike, and this past week they've started quietly testing out what their platform would be like if they removed it.

    Ocean West reacted to CoffeeCake in Show all accounts with log in attempts fail?   
    I can see a use case for some organizations where this exchange may happen over the phone and that the answers (depending on the questions) may be such where visual inspection of the provided answers could be a part of what happens for identity validation.
    That said though, I think it's important that accessing those answers be considered a heightened privilege event. The option should exist to require the administrator to reauthenticate along with their own 2FA if configured as such, and should record an audit trail that the information was accessed by the administrator at said date and time.
    We place trust in those we give privileged access to, however we should be able to verify that those responsibilities are not being abused by the individuals themselves or by a compromise affecting that individual's accounts.
